42nd Annual Tour of Homes 2012 by Matt McCabe  The 2012 Washington County Tour of Homes was held during the second week of July and the results are in: Success! All the home builders who put their models on display gave positive feedback regarding the quantity and - and the quality - of this year's visitors. Several measurable factors from the 2012 TOH continue to support the trends that suggest an improving housing market. Even though the number of participating builders was down, the overall number of visitors was slightly up from last year's event. Definitely positive indicators that the home building industry is starting to see a rebound! In addition to the numbers, reports from builders and visitors alike indicate that a good time was had by all. The official drawing for the Bingo Card was held Thursday morning and the announced live on the radio station WBKV 1420am much to the delight of the winners. Many thanks go out to all who participated in and attended the 2012 Washington County Builders Association Tour of Homes. We look forward to another successful event in 2013. |
